How to Make Ultimate Lemon Lavender Cheesecake

  1. Preheat & Prepare: Preheat your oven to 325°F (163°C) and prepare a springform pan by lining it with parchment paper. This ensures the cheesecake releases easily post-baking.

  2. Make the Crust: In a mixing bowl, combine graham cracker crumbs, sugar, salt, and melted vegan butter. Press the mixture firmly into the bottom of the springform pan. Bake it for 10 minutes and then let it cool completely.

  3. Infuse Lavender: In a small bowl, steep culinary lavender in lemon juice for about 10 minutes to extract its flavor. Strain the mixture to remove the lavender buds; however, you can retain a few for a more intense floral touch if desired.

  4. Mix the Filling: Beat the vegan cream cheese until smooth in a large bowl. Gradually add sugar, followed by the flaxseed mixture (or chia seeds) and vanilla extract. Slowly incorporate sour cream, lemon zest, and the infused lemon juice. Be careful not to overmix; it should be creamy but not too airy.

  5. Bake: Pour the filling over the cooled crust in the pan. Place the pan in a water bath and bake for 50-60 minutes until the center is slightly set, with a gentle jiggle. Turn off the oven, crack open the door, and let the cheesecake rest for 30 minutes. Then refrigerate for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ight.

  6. Top & Serve: When ready to serve, add pieces of fresh honeycomb on top of the cheesecake. Drizzle some honey (or a vegan alternative) over it and garnish with a sprinkle of lavender buds and lemon zest for a beautiful presentation.

Optional: Serve with fresh berries for an extra burst of flavor and color.

Expert Tips for Ultimate Lemon Lavender Cheesecake

  • Ingredient Temperature: Ensure all ingredients are at room temperature before mixing. This will create a smoother filling and prevent lumps in your cheesecake.

  • Water Bath Magic: Always bake your cheesecake in a water bath. This method prevents cracks, leading to a beautifully uniform texture in your Ultimate Lemon Lavender Cheesecake.

  • Mix with Care: Avoid overmixing your filling. Overmixing can lead to a dense texture instead of the light, airy cheesecake you desire.

  • Chill Before Topping: Allow the cheesecake to chill completely before adding honeycomb. This helps maintain its structure and ensures the honeycomb stays crunchy on top.

  • Flavorful Infusion: Don’t forget to steep the lavender in lemon juice! This technique enhances the floral notes and brings out the unique flavor of the cheesecake.

How to Store and Freeze Ultimate Lemon Lavender Cheesecake

Fridge: Keep your vegan cheesecake covered with plastic wrap or in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 5 days. This will maintain its creamy texture and vibrant flavors.

Freezer: If you need to store leftovers, wrap individual slices tightly in plastic wrap and place them in a freezer-safe container. It can last for up to 2 months without losing its delightful taste.

Thawing: To enjoy a frozen slice, transfer it to the fridge overnight to thaw. Avoid microwaving, as it can alter the texture of this sophisticated dessert.

Reheating: This cheesecake is best served chilled, so no reheating is necessary. Just remove it from the refrigerator and add your toppings, including that crunchy honeycomb!

What should I do if my cheesecake cracks while baking?
No worries! If your cheesecake cracks, it could be due to overmixing or baking at too high a temperature. To prevent this, ensure all ingredients are at room temperature and don’t mix too vigorously. Additionally, always bake using a water bath; this helps regulate temperature and prevents cracks from forming.

Can I modify the recipe to accommodate allergies?
Very much so! Instead of using flaxseed or chia seeds as an egg replacement, you could substitute with aquafaba (the liquid from canned chickpeas) which also works well as a binding agent. If someone has a nut allergy, just make sure to use a nut-free cream cheese alternative.

Ingredients
  

Crust
  • 1 cup Graham Crackers or gluten-free biscuits
  • 1/4 cup Sugar coconut sugar for a natural alternative
  • 1/4 teaspoon Salt sea salt is best
  • 1/2 cup Vegan Butter or coconut oil
Filling
  • 1 tablespoon Culinary Lavender food-grade
  • 1/3 cup Lemon Juice fresh-squeezed
  • 8 oz Vegan Cream Cheese or blended cashew cream
  • 1/2 cup Vegan Sour Cream or dairy-free yogurt
  • 1 tablespoon Flaxseed Meal or chia seed mixture for binding
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ract almond extract can be used
Topping
  • 1 cup Honeycomb or vegan candy

Equipment

  • Springform Pan
  • Mixing bowl
  • Oven
  • Baking sheet

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Preheat your oven to 325°F (163°C) and line a springform pan with parchment paper.
  2. Combine graham cracker crumbs, sugar, salt, and melted vegan butter in a bowl. Press mixture into the bottom of the pan. Bake for 10 minutes and cool.
  3. Steep culinary lavender in lemon juice for 10 minutes. Strain mixture to remove lavender buds.
  4. Beat vegan cream cheese until smooth. Gradually add sugar, flaxseed mixture, and vanilla extract. Incorporate sour cream, lemon zest, and the infused lemon juice.
  5. Pour filling over the cooled crust. Bake in a water bath for 50-60 minutes until slightly set. Allow to cool in the oven for 30 minutes and then refrigerate for at least 4 hours.
  6. Top cheesecake with honeycomb. Drizzle with honey or vegan alternative. Garnish with lavender buds and lemon zest.
